Changes in Pectic substances and Cell Wall Hydrolases during Ripening and Storage of Apple Fruits




Abstract
Changes in flesh firmness, alcohol-insoluble substances (AIS), total pectic substances (TPS), and cell wall hydrolases of ¢¥Tsugaru¢¥, ¢¥Jonagold¢¥ and ¢¥Fuji¢¥ apple fruits during ripening and storage were investigated.
Flesh firmness was rapidly declined in ¢¥Tsugaru¢¥ and ¢¥Jonagold¢¥, while slowly in ¢¥Fuji¢¥ during ripening and storage. Among the cultivars the contents of AIS, TPS and insoluble pectic substances (IPS) were highest in ¢¥Tsugaru¢¥ and lowest in ¢¥Fuji¢¥ and they declined greatly until the harvesting time. However, contents of AIS, TPS, and IPS were not changed during storage of ¢¥Jonagold¢¥ and ¢¥Fuji¢¥ apples, while they declined continuously up to 40 days after initiation of storage in ¢¥Tsugaru¢¥. Water-soluble pectin (WSP) declined until the harvesting time, while increased during the storage. WSP contents of fruits before harvest were highest in ¢¥fsugaru¢¥ and lowest in ¢¥Jonagold¢¥ among the cultivars. No differences were observed in WSP between ¢¥Tsugaru¢¥ and ¢¥Fuji¢¥ during storage, whereas WSP contents were significantly lower in ¢¥Jonagold¢¥. Versene -soluble pectin (VSP) declined through the maturation, but slowly increased during the storage. In general, VSP in ¢¥Fuji was higher than in ¢¥Tsugaru¢¥ and ¢¥Jonagold¢¥ during the storage. Activity of ¥â-galactosidase increased continuously during the maturation and storage, and the rate of increase was highest in ¢¥Tsugaru¢¥ Activities of polygalacturonase (PG) in all cultivars were very low through 20 days before harvest, while they were highest at harvesting time in ¢¥Tsugaru¢¥ and ¢¥Jonagold¢¥ and at 20 days after initiation of storage in ¢¥Fuji¢¥, and then declined in all cultivars. Pectinmethylesterase (PME) activity was declined with fruit maturation in all cultivars, and ¢¥Tsugaru¢¥ and ¢¥Jonagold¢¥ showed higher activities of that than ¢¥Fuji¢¥. However PME activity of ¢¥Fuji¢¥ compared to ¢¥Tsugaru¢¥ and ¢¥Jonagold¢¥ increased significantly during storage.
